1. Compare Prices Beforehand
Perhaps one of the easiest tricks on this list of ways to save money when shopping online is to simply compare prices before making any purchases.
It should come as no surprise that the same product can be available for sale on various websites for various prices. Before purchasing anything online, it is important to check the final rate one would pay on various platforms before purchasing anything online. Some aspects to consider include the following:
- Product price
- Shipping charges
- Coupon discounts
- Cashbacks
- Bank or payment discounts
- Delivery charges
- Return/replacement policy
It will not take long to find a better deal that one can purchase without breaking the bank.

3. Focus on Your Desired Final Price Rather Than the Percentage Off
While "70% OFF" may seem like a fantastic deal, one must also keep in mind that the percentage off is merely an indication of how much one is spending in comparison to the original cost of a product.
Instead of focusing one's attention on the massive percentage off being offered on a product, one should instead focus on the final price one plans to pay for a product. For example, one should consider the following:
Product A: Rs. 5,000 (50% Off) = Rs. 2,500
Product B: Rs. 3,500 (20% Off) = Rs. 2,800
While one might think Product B would be a better deal with its smaller percentage off, Product A is significantly less expensive. One should also keep in mind whether the original price was reasonable and whether a product has been discounted lower than a previous selling price.
Tip: Always compare the sale price to the typical selling price for a given product.

7. Set a Budget for Online Shopping
As enticing as a 30% off coupon for a Rs. 1,000 product may be, it does not change the fact that one would still be spending Rs. 700 for a single product. Before shopping, it is important to set a budget for online shopping, in accordance with one's income and expenses.
Having a shopping budget can help one to keep track of spending in accordance with one's income and expenses.
8. Keep an Eye Out on the Final Bill
The price of the product one is considering purchasing might not account for all of the costs that one will pay for the product in the end, especially if additional costs are involved. Before paying for a product, it is wise to check for any of the following potential additional charges:
- Delivery Charges
- Platform Charges
- Convenience Charges
- Installation Charges
- Warranty Charges
- Tax
- Minimum Order Value
For example, one would not really benefit from a Rs. 100 off coupon when one would end up having to pay an additional Rs. 150 in other charges.
9. Save Items in Your Wishlist Before Buying
If one comes across a product that they are interested in, one should be sure to save it to their wishlist rather than buying it off the spot before clicking "Buy Now".
This will help one to minimize impulsive buying and allow them to make a more considered decision on one's purchases. After a few days or so, one should ask oneself whether they would have still bought the product had there been no coupon for it.
If one's answer is no, it is likely that the discount was the only reason one might have considered buying the product.

A Simple Online Shopping Checklist
Before clicking "Buy Now", one should always ask oneself these questions:
Do I actually need this product?
Did I compare prices?
Did I check available coupon/discount codes?
Is there a better promo code or cashback offer?
Is the current price really competitive?
Are there any additional charges?
Have I checked reviews?
What is the return or replacement policy?
Can I wait for a potential price drop?
Does the purchase fit my budget?
If one can answer these questions, one is more likely to make a smarter purchase.
